the short one top left is a push fit straight to a short metal spout on the front hight corector,
the slightly longer one bottom left is a push fit to one of the metal pipes atatched to the underside of the O/S/F chassis rail, that continues onto one of the strut return/leg pipe's,
the long one bottom left runs through a plastic tube and across the sub frame cross beam, and on to one of the N/S leg pipes via the metal link pipe under that chassis rail,
the two spouts pointing towards the top of the picy have two plastic trickle return pipes pluged into
(one lightly fatter than the other), so should go in the apropriate sized spout,
in the crutch and pointing to the right are two more spouts which take the two plastic return pipes which run inside the plastic sleave on the sub frame cross beam,
then there is a port on the face faceing you in the picy which a short length of black plastic pipe plugs into then continues on to the other O/S strut return/leg pipe,
the usual point the pussy fails used to be the shortest pipe on the left as it bends round tight then on the the hight corector,
the main block/body of the beast just sits on the lower section of the front sub frame behind the O/S intermediate drive shaft joint, and along side the front hight corector,
when you have had as much prctise as i you can fit one in around 2 hours,
i just cut all the tenticals of and pull the dead bits out, then fit the new,
